Salomon Aero Blaze 3 ($140)
Execs:
Low slung, delicate, energetic, enjoyable and properly cushioned experience: Sam/Michael/Jamie
Even when delicate using, steady from heel via midfoot with no sinking mush feeling: Michael/Sam/Jamie
Extremely-versatile shoe – a real do all of it! Michael/Jamie
Mild weight for stack top: sub 8 oz / 227g, 35 mm heel / 27 mm forefoot: Sam/Michael
Snug delicate and pleasant higher with simple cross over to each day put on: Sam/Jamie
Cons:
Heavier runners could over compress the delicate midsole, particularly upfront: Sam
Extra midfoot higher help: tongue may use a gusset: Sam/Michael/Jamie
Middle forefoot outsole pod has under common grip on moist (identical with AeroGlide 3): Sam/Michael
Barely slender match, not best for wider toes: Jamie
Stats
Approx. Weight: males’s 7.9 oz / 223g US9 Spec. girls’s 6.8oz / 193g US7.5
Pattern Weights:
males’s 7.7oz / 217g US8.5
Stack Peak: 35 mm heel / 27 mm forefoot, 8mm drop
Platform Width: 85 mm heel / 70 mm midfoot / 105 mm forefoot (US M8.5)

First Impressions, Match and Higher
Michael: Expectations had been excessive for the Salomon Aero Blaze 3 (a minimum of for me) – the Aero Glide 3 represented a large step ahead from Salomon, and has grow to be certainly one of my most-recommended footwear of the yr. Thus, it’s my pleasure to report that, from the primary step-in, the Aero Blaze 3 impresses. With a dialed-in stability between consolation and responsiveness, Salomon has executed a fantastic job to trim down the higher right here – even in comparison with the Aero Glide 3 – choosing a barely thinner, extra breathable engineered mesh that sheds a number of grams with out sacrificing construction. I’ll overuse the time period “race prepared” (and in the end, this isn’t a shoe designed for racing) however Salomon has actually executed job to incorporate the whole lot you want right here (and nothing you don’t).
Much like the Aero Glide, the match is true to measurement with average to barely beneficiant quantity. The toe field affords a contact extra width than older Salomon fashions, aided by a stretchy entrance mesh and no intrusive inner seams. The heel counter is semi-rigid and externalized, permitting a safe rear lockdown with out further weight or strain factors.
This was very removed from the harshest shoe on my Haugland’s bump, and I might advocate it to Achilles-plagued runners like myself. The tongue is flippantly padded and un-gusseted, however I didn’t have any points – the lockdown total is stable and will work properly for many foot varieties with minor lacing changes.
Jamie: After testing out the Aero Glide 3 and falling in love with it, my expectations had been excessive for the Aero Blaze 3. Within the present working world the place stack top, cushion, and extra shoe is usually higher, the Aero Blaze 3 delivers a smooth design and a shoe that may do all of it.
Within the scorching summer time days we’ve had, the higher is tremendous mild and breathable, and virtually unnoticeable whereas offering a safe lockdown. Whereas the Aero Blaze 3 ran a couple of half measurement massive and felt prefer it supplied lots of quantity, the Aero Glide matches a lot narrower and true to measurement. As somebody with a wider foot, the match was nonetheless spot on, however one thing to contemplate in case you are between sizes.
As somebody who doesn’t have a tendency to like overly delicate footwear, the Aero Blaze 3 is ideal. It’s mild, responsive, and a non-plated choice for each day coaching.
Sam: the Blaze has a smooth, trendy and streamlined look. Whereas the toe seems “pointy” on foot, decrease quantity toes may very well discover it not solely a bit lengthy however highish quantity as a consequence of its delicate unstructured higher and barely stretchy mesh.
On a number of events I’ve reached for it over dozens of others for informal put on, that snug and simple becoming publish runs.
Maintain is reasonably safe however not what I might name a “efficiency” match as say the just lately examined (RTR Evaluation) Puma Velocity Nitro 4 has. Specifically I be aware the shortage of a gusset for the softly padded tongue. That is one higher and shoe supposed for shifting alongside that requires a gusset or a extra substantial tongue design to wrap the highest of the foot.
Thankfully the rising midsole aspect partitions “Energetic Chassis” and an virtually inflexible heel counter maintain issues adequately underneath management.
Midsole & Platform
Michael: The center of the Blaze 3 is the optiFOAM² midsole, a formulation designed to ship each plush landings and high-energy rebound. In comparison with the deeper, barely denser eTPU experience of the Glide 3, the Blaze feels a contact softer and extra versatile underfoot, best for runners on the lookout for a handy guide a rough and forgiving on a regular basis coach. That is squarely and definitively a “do all of it” coach – you may legitimately do your slowest and quickest miles of the week in the identical choice. No, there’s no plate – however I had no points taking these to tempo. They’re a severely enjoyable and versatile choice.
The 36/28 mm stack nonetheless affords loads of safety whereas holding the shoe agile and low sufficient for good floor really feel. The geometry makes use of a refined rocker that encourages ahead momentum with out feeling overly aggressive. Mixed with the sunshine building, it provides the Blaze 3 a “disappear on foot” high quality that makes it a pleasure throughout a large tempo vary. Like I stated, it is a true jack-of-all-trades midsole – sufficient cushion for longer runs, sufficient response for tempo work, and a balanced experience that feels acceptable even throughout warmups or cooldowns. Quick lengthy runs are in all probability probably the most on-target singular run I can counsel however, severely – you’ll be able to actually use these for any miles you may have assigned. They’re extraordinarily versatile because of this soft-but-springy midsole.
Jamie: Merely put, the Aero Blaze 3 offers a cushioned, but springy midsole. For those who’re on the lookout for a each day coach that feels supportive, however not mushy, that is the shoe for you. Nonetheless, I’ll say that on some longer runs, I typically felt like I might go for the Aero Glide 3 over this shoe. Particularly underneath the forefoot, I wished just a bit extra cushion on the pavement working within the concrete jungle that’s Chicago. Nonetheless, this shoe actually felt the most effective switching from gravel to pavement, and seems like an ideal hybrid that may handle all terrain very properly.
Whereas it affords a typically highish stack top, it seems like a low profile shoe, in comparison with most lately, and really steady. It has unimaginable versatility, and total a enjoyable experience.
Sam: The supercritical, expanded eTPU beads midsole right here for certain is vigorous, delicate and enjoyable whereas by no means mushy. For those who like a delicate energetic experience that provides again greater than sinks away the optiFoam right here is for you. The identical foam and common geometry is within the Aero Glide 3 (RTR Evaluation) with the important thing distinction the Aero Glide 3 at 40 mm heel / 32mm forefoot so is 5mm larger stack. Whereas “extra cushioned” its experience is much less steady, much less direct, stiffer and fewer enjoyable. The 35/27 stack right here is loads of cushion with the platform extra agile, extra versatile and total is extra dynamic. This can be a platform and midsole that for certain likes to zip alongside!
I do want for a contact extra on the highway entrance response and snap. I believe the difficulty is a part of the entrance outsole rubber sample.
Outsole
Michael: The outsole options zoned Contagrip rubber in high-wear areas and a lighter foam uncovered middle part to cut back weight. The grip on dry roads is superb, and sturdiness seems sturdy after preliminary testing. Nonetheless, as with the Glide 3, the moist grip could possibly be improved, particularly on smoother pavement. There’s lots of rubber right here, nevertheless it isn’t deep.
Jamie: The outsole reveals some put on after preliminary testing, however doesn’t influence the experience of the shoe. That is the place it excels on gravel and softer surfaces over moist pavement because of the traction changing into a slight concern. I wouldn’t need to do pace work on moist roads after about 100 miles of wear and tear, however working on the paths, and a few off highway sections, this shoe actually involves life.
Sam: The outsole design rings the complete sole with rubber that’s fairly agency. This can be a sensible alternative because the ring helps stabilize the delicate foam midsole and mitigate results of the large middle cutouts which cut back weight and permit ahead move.
The middle entrance white rubber is a softer rubber. The Glide 3 had the identical design and rubber upfront. Whereas this rubber softens the experience but extra there (perhaps an excessive amount of for my tastes) I believe it additionally takes away some response and toe off snap the firmer blue rubber may ship. And as with the Giide 3 I discovered this space of the outsole had lower than common grip in moist situations.
Journey, Conclusions and Suggestions
Michael: Step apart, Aero Glide – the Aero Blaze 3 could also be probably the most under-the-radar hits of the latest previous, and is a straightforward contender for my coach of the yr. It’s a each day coach that doesn’t simply do the whole lot – it does the whole lot properly. From restoration miles to strides, brief efforts to double-digit runs, it persistently delivers clean transitions, dynamic cushioning, and all-day consolation. None of that is to knock the Aero Glide – if you’d like somewhat extra underfoot, the Aero Glide does the whole lot principally simply as properly, with the added value of lugging round a pair extra grams. Personally, I actually dig the svelte, virtually old-school really feel of the Blaze (particularly at $140!), however – Salomon, as the youngsters say, is cooking.
For those who’re solely shopping for one shoe this yr – or in case you want a each day “do-it-all” coach to enhance your tremendous shoe racer – the Salomon Aero Blaze 3 deserves a critical look.
😊😊😊😊½
Rating: 9.5 / 10
Jamie: The Aero Blaze 3 is the shoe for you if you’d like a flexible each day coach that isn’t plated, but offers a light-weight, agency, supportive experience. It has nice traction for gravel runs on days the place you don’t need to hit the pavement. Personally, I nonetheless suppose I a lot favor the Aero Glide 3 for my do all of it each day coach. With a wider match, and somewhat extra cushion for pounding the pavement over some longer runs, the Aero Glide 3 takes the sting over the Aero Blaze 3 in total match and efficiency.
The Blaze is responsive, safe, and offers a rocker that feels actually clean from heel to toe. Nonetheless, it’s barely slender, outsole leaves one thing to be desired, and forefoot may use somewhat extra cushion for these restoration days. Salomon has actually stepped up their sport with their lineup and the Aero Blaze 3 nonetheless delivers a high notch expertise.
Rating: 8.5 / 10
😊😊😊😊
Sam: Want a break or change in your rotation of plated and max cushioned trainers? Desire a single coach for quite a lot of decently quick paced each day runs? In search of a smooth trendy shoe that’s enjoyable to run but can simply and stylishly cross over to extra informal use. The Blaze 3 checks all these bins for me.
Whereas it lacks considerably in higher help and likewise entrance response and stability for both lengthy runs or quick intervals for many each day miles it’s an thrilling choice that left me each run with massive smiles.
Commendably mild at 7.9 oz / 223g US9 for its substantial 35/27 stack top and with a vigorous and enjoyable to run all supercritical foam midsole at $140 it’s also a wonderful worth.
Sam’s Rating: 9.25 /10
Deductions for extra midfoot higher maintain and extra forefoot response (outsole)

6 Comparisons
ASICS Novablast (RTR Evaluation)
Sam: The favored Novablast at $150 is larger stacked at 42/34 and a extra rocker based mostly stiff shoe than the ASICS. Its non supercritical however tremendous FF Blast Plus midsole and the stack top make it 25g heavier than the Salomon however nonetheless a really mild shoe for its stack top. I discovered its mild higher snug and perhaps a contact safer than the Blaze’s however nonetheless needing a bit extra work. I favor the Nova for longer runs and the Salomon for shorter sooner ones though each are extra uptempo in focus than simple run( jogging) choices.
New Stability Insurgent v5 (RTR Evaluation)
Michael: The NB Insurgent v5 retains the Insurgent line on the forefront of what “enjoyable trainers” will be – it’s not laden with loopy building just like the SC Coach, nevertheless it does greater than sufficient to satisfy the brink of vigorous, gratifying, fun-to-run coach. My foot strike (and maybe foot form) simply works somewhat higher within the Blaze, and so it’s my desire, however I don’t have many destructive issues to say in regards to the new Insurgent. For those who’re a longtime Insurgent fan (particularly v4), I’d give v5 a glance – however in case you’re approaching the choice contemporary, then I’d severely think about Salomon.
Jamie: For those who’re on the lookout for enjoyable versatile trainers, you actually can’t go unsuitable with the Insurgent or the Blaze. Each non plated footwear are responsive, light-weight, and can be a fantastic choice if I wished 1 shoe for the whole lot. I do actually benefit from the cushioning of the Insurgent and the broader platform, whereas I favor the rocker really feel and total stability of the Blaze. With each within the working shoe rotation, they’re each nice choices! They do match very comparable when it comes to sizing, so in case you’re in between sizes, I positively advocate sizing up.
Nike Pegasus Plus (RTR Evaluation)
Michael: That is the closest comparability, in my guide. Each are extraordinarily enjoyable and eminently usable footwear, I actually suppose each are what trainers must be! Between the 2, it’s shut! The Pegasus Plus is softer and feels somewhat extra propulsive, whereas the Blaze is barely firmer (barely!), with extra of a spring impact from the midsole. Once more – they’re actually shut. Neither lacing system is ideal (the tongue slides round on each footwear, non-problematically). Outsoles… once more, I believe fairly comparable when it comes to use case. I just like the aesthetics of the Nike extra, however I discover the match of the Salomon is a bit more pleasant. Could be a toss-up, however the larger value of the Nike (at $180-$190) in comparison with the Salomon at $140 does make the Blaze stand out forward, if solely by a hair.
Puma Velocity Nitro 4 (RTR Evaluation)
Sam: The Puma at 36/26 has virtually the identical stats however is 22g heavier however nonetheless mild in its class. It too has a full supercritical foam midsole. In its case a nitrogen infused EVA. it’s higher is significantly safer and efficiency in match. Each true to measurement. The Puma clearly has a superior outsole and might cruise over to mild trails. On the identical nice $140 value factors, Salomon is extra enjoyable and extra vigorous but however the Puma wins on versatility as it’s higher suited to sooner paces in addition to even some mild trails than the Blaze
Salomon Aero Glide 3 (RTR Evaluation)
Jamie: Each the Aero Glide 3 and the Aero Blaze 3 are versatile each day trainers that may deal with something from pace to lengthy runs, highway to path. The Aero Glide 3 matches a couple of half measurement massive and has a good quantity of quantity, whereas the Aero Blaze 3 is way narrower and true to measurement. The Aero Glide 3 excels on the highway with the cushion and responsiveness, whereas the Aero Blaze 3 feels just like the hybrid, highway/path shoe, that feels superb on gravel and softer surfaces.
Brooks Launch (RTR Evaluation)
Michael: The Brooks Launch was certainly one of my most stunning footwear; it’s Brooks’s “down market” choice ($120) however actually an gratifying coach that nails the fundamentals (and somewhat further). The Blaze has extra to it – a much bigger stack of froth underfoot and a extra gratifying platform – and might be extra usable for many runs. However the Launch is nice in case you’re on the lookout for one thing much more streamlined and minimal (comparatively talking). Each nice, although I favor the Blaze.
